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Chattogram to Amsterdam is to fly and train which costs €360 - €1000 and takes 17h 28m.
The fastest way to get from Chattogram to Amsterdam is to fly which takes 13h 43m and costs €350 - €1000.
The distance between Chattogram and Amsterdam is 7908 km.
It takes approximately 13h 43m to get from Chattogram to Amsterdam, including transfers.
Amsterdam is 4h behind Chattogram. It is currently 4:17 PM in Chattogram and 12:17 PM in Amsterdam.
